Meteora is a must see for all. November was an excellent month. The weather was great and we had all the beautiful colours of autumn to enjoy. The actual rocks offer exquisite views, the countryside is amazing and the monasteries built right on top of the rocks are out of this world - which is (as was explained to us) what the first monks who went up there, were actually aiming at! In town, after the Meteora tour, we had dinner in a local taverna called Archodariki which offered excellent local food, high prices however! Kalambaka is very easy to see, its a long road that goes through the centre of the small town, half an hour, you've seen it all. Don't miss the Natural History and Mushrooms museum!!!

Very beautiful traditional Greek mountain village with small shops (local products) and few restaurants. Difficult to find parking in the center of the village, one public parking but it's very small. Easy to make road trips around Pelion area - go around if you have a car, this is one of the most beautiful regions in Greece (also in summer, not only winter). Some part of the roads (in Pelion area, not in Portaria) were destroyed in winter 2024 during storms. Unfortunately, they were still destroyed in July 2024. You can go around by car, roads are not closed, but needs a bit attention in many places and wouldn't recommend to drive at night (dark). Time from Portaria to beach (Agios Ioannis, Papa Nero) took from us abt 40 min so take your time. To Village "Kala Nera" (nice beach, long with plenty of place in July) a bit less.

A magical area of Greece worth spending 2 - 3 full days or more. The Monestaries, the Hermit Caves, Prehistoric Theopetra Cave, the early Greek Orthodox Churches, such as the byzantine church of the Assumption of Virgin Mary , and the Hellenistic and Roman ruins - are all worth spending the time to visit and learn more about them.

Tsagarada is a charming village, renowned for its extraordinary natural beauty and unique setting. Settled in the heart of a chestnut forest, it attracts many visitors during the summertime who come to enjoy its peaceful atmosphere, breathtaking views and offering of an excellent traditional cuisine deeply rooted in the Pelion region’s rich culinary heritage. Founded in 1500, Tsagarada is composed of four picturesque settlements, each centered around beautifully restored old churches: Taxiarches, Agia Paraskevi, Agia Kyriaki, and Agios Stephanos. These churches are notable for their exquisite wooden carved iconostases. Tsagarada offers a perfect blend of nature, history, and tradition, making it a truly unforgettable destination.
